On Tuesday May 20, a conference organized in partnership with the Vendanges du Savoir will be held. The conference will be open to symposium participants and the general public.
The event will take place at the same venue as the symposium (Agora auditorium, domaine du Haut-Carré, Talence).
The conference will be preceded by a tasting of wines from grape varieties resistant to mildew and powdery mildew, led by an oenologist.
7.00pm: wine tasting
7.30pm: start of the conference proper.
We will be delighted to welcome Olivier Jacquet (University of Burgundy) and François Delmotte (INRAE) to present their thoughts on the theme ‘A historian's and a biologist's perspective on the emergence of vine diseases in the 19th century: the history of invasions and their impact on the wine industry, its standards and practices’.
